The intensity of electromagnetic waves from the sun is 1.4 kW/m^2 just above the earth’s atmosphere. Eighty percent of this reaches the surface at noon on a clear summer day.
Suppose you model your back as a 27cm & 51cm rectangle.
How many joules of solar energy fall on your back as you work on your tan for 0.70h?

80% of 1.4 = 1.12 kW / m²
Area = 0.27 * 0.51 = 0.138 m²
Power = 1.12 * 0.138 = 0.154 kW
Energy = Power * Time
Time = 0.7 * 3600 = 2520 seconds
Energy = 0.154 * 2520 = 389 Joules
